Canal+: acquisition of the operator M7, a channel distributor present in eight European countries

News Tank Football - Paris - News #155466 - Published on

"The Canal+ Group is pleased to have obtained the green light from the European Commission to finalise the acquisition of the operator M7 (a Luxembourg-based channel aggregator and distributor), in accordance with the agreement announced on 27/05/2019. The operation will be completed in the next few days," announced the free and pay-TV group on 05/09/2019.

"This very large-scale acquisition will allow the Canal+ Group to establish itself in eight new European countries, and to reach a customer base of 20 million subscribers worldwide by the end of 2019, including 12 million outside France. M7 is a major European operator, offering television services under different platforms (satellite, DTT, OTT and IPTV) and operating under various brands in the following countries: The Netherlands, Romania, Czech Republic, Slovakia, Hungary, Austria, Belgium, and Germany," said Canal+.
